During this time, the total external debt had risen to over $70 billion . Akin to Pakistan’s current crisis, India too was downgraded by Moody. The situation became so catastrophic that the Chandra Shekhar government could not even pass the budget in February 1991. The downgrading by Moody also meant that borrowing from international creditors had become more costly. Inflation hovered high around 14% followed by low growth and rising unemployment. In 1991, India was suffering a twin deficit where its fiscal deficit was around 8.4% of its GDP and its current account deficit was around 3% of the GDP.

However, the question now is whether the citizens can bring themselves to trust the Imran Khan government with their hard-earned gold. According to the proposal, the commercial banks will issue a negotiable discounted instrument to the gold owner and pay an interest rate on the precious metal. The commercial bank will deposit the gold with the SBP that can monetise it to increase the foreign exchange reserves –already largely built by taking expensive foreign loans.

The Imran Khan government has a new proposal to boost the country’s foreign exchange reserves. The proposal involves more borrowing for the Pakistan economy that is already crippled under rising debts, but this time the plan is to borrow gold from its citizens. Are Pakistan reserves all time high?

Foreign Exchange Reserves in Pakistan averaged 16651.09 USD Million from 1998 until 2023, reaching an all time high of 27067.70 USD Million in August of 2021 and a record low of 1973.60 USD Million in December of 1999.

What is national gold reserve of Pakistan?

Pakistan currently holds $3.82 billion worth of gold.

BNP-M’s President Sardar Akhtar Mengal expressed concern about bill being passed overnight in National Assembly. Mengal claimed that Balochistan’s resources have been taken as “maal-e-ghanimat” by foreigners and Pakistani elites. Minister of Housing and Works, Maulana Abdul Wasay, opposed the bill and emphasized that it would take away the resources of the province without the say of the local government. With this new legislation, China will get a “free run to make loot in this country with the connivance of the Pakistani political and military elites” and deprive the people of Pakistan of growth, livelihood, and prosperity. Several lawmakers and Pakistani leaders have raised concerns regarding the new legislation. The mining agreement was signed in 2006 between Canada’s Barrick Gold, Chile’s Antofagasta and the Balochistan government in a revenue-sharing model, according to Financial Post.

How much is Pakistan foreign reserve?

Foreign exchange reserves of State Bank of Pakistan (SBP) have been increased by $487 million to $4.301 billion by the week ended March 03, 2023, as compared with $3.814 billion a week ago, February 24, according to official data released on Thursday.
